Former Indian skipper Kapil Dev made history when he led his team to its grand victory during the 1983 ICC Cricket World Cup. Decades later, ace filmmaker Kabir Khan decided to recreate the iconic win on the silver screen by making a biopic based on Kapil Dev’s life.

While there were reports that the makers were considering ‘Mubarakan’ star Arjun Kapoor to play the former captain in the movie, recent reports suggest that Arjun's BFF Ranveer Singh has replaced him and has been finalised for the movie. Ranveer, in fact, is a huge cricket fan and was recently spotted at the Edgbaston stadium in Birmingham, watching the India Vs Pakistan match.

The film will be produced by Anurag Kashyap and will go on floors in 2018.
